    Synonyms for "technology"

    technology applied science engineering engineering science

    "technology" definitions

    the application of the knowledge and usage of tools (such as machines or utensils) and techniques to control one's environment


    the discipline dealing with the art or science of applying scientific knowledge to practical problems


    machinery and equipment developed from engineering or other applied sciences
